3.导包,这是非常重要的一步,需要将我们使用的spring、springMVC和MyBatis的相关包都导进来,直接使用maven依赖。
直接上pom.xml的源码:
<?xml version="1.0" encoding="UTF-8"?> <project xmlns="http://maven.apache.org/POM/4.0.0"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d"> <modelVersion>4.0.0</modelVersion> <groupId>com.viking.SSDemo</groupId> <artifactId>SSMDemo</artifactId> <version>1.0-SNAPSHOT</version> <packaging>war</packaging> <name>SSMDemo Maven Webapp</name> <url>http://www.example.com</url> <properties> <spring.version>5.0.0.RELEASE</spring.version> <mybatis.version>3.4.5</mybatis.version> <slf4j.version>1.7.25</slf4j.version> <log4j.version>1.2.17</log4j.version> </properties> <dependencies> <dependency> <groupId>junit</groupId> <artifactId>junit</artifactId> <version>4.11</version> <scope>test</scope>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-core</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-web</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-oxm</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-tx</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-jdbc</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-webmvc</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-aop</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-context-support</artifactId> <version>${spring.version}</version> </dependency>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-test</artifactId> <version>${spring.version}</version> <scope>test</scope> </dependency> <dependency> <groupId>org.mybatis</groupId> <artifactId>mybatis</artifactId> <version>${mybatis.version}</version> </dependency> <dependency> <groupId>com.github.pagehelper</groupId> <artifactId>pagehelper</artifactId> <version>4.1.6</version> </dependency> <dependency> <groupId>tk.mybatis</groupId> <artifactId>mapper</artifactId> <version>3.3.8</version> </dependency> <dependency> <groupId>org.mybatis</groupId> <artifactId>mybatis-spring</artifactId> <version>1.3.1</version> </dependency> <dependency> <groupId>javax</groupId> <artifactId>javaee-api</artifactId> <version>8.0</version> <scope>provided</scope> </dependency> <dependency> <groupId>mysql</groupId> <artifactId>mysql-connector-java</artifactId> <version>5.1.39</version> </dependency> <dependency> <groupId>commons-dbcp</groupId> <artifactId>commons-dbcp</artifactId> <version>1.4</version> </dependency> <dependency> <groupId>jstl</groupId> <artifactId>jstl</artifactId> <version>1.2</version> </dependency> <dependency> <groupId>log4j</groupId> <artifactId>log4j</artifactId> <version>${log4j.version}</version> </dependency> <dependency> <groupId>org.slf4j</groupId> <artifactId>slf4j-log4j12</artifactId> <version>${slf4j.version}</version> </dependency> <dependency> <groupId>org.slf4j</groupId> <artifactId>slf4j-api</artifactId> <version>${slf4j.version}</version> </dependency> <dependency> <groupId>com.alibaba</groupId> <artifactId>fastjson</artifactId> <version>1.2.42</version> </dependency> <dependency> <groupId>org.codehaus.jackson</groupId> <artifactId>jackson-mapper-asl</artifactId> <version>1.9.13</version> </dependency> <dependency> <groupId>commons-fileupload</groupId> <artifactId>commons-fileupload</artifactId> <version>1.3.3</version> </dependency> <dependency> <groupId>commons-io</groupId> <artifactId>commons-io</artifactId> <version>2.6</version> </dependency> <dependency> <groupId>commons-codec</groupId> <artifactId>commons-codec</artifactId> <version>1.11</version> </dependency> </dependencies> <build> <finalName>SSMDemo</finalName> <pluginManagement> <plugins> <plugin> <artifactId>maven-clean-plugin</artifactId> <version>3.0.0</version> </plugin> <plugin> <artifactId>maven-resources-plugin</artifactId> <version>3.0.2</version> </plugin> <plugin> <artifactId>maven-compiler-plugin</artifactId> <version>3.7.0</version> </plugin> <plugin> <artifactId>maven-surefire-plugin</artifactId> <version>2.20.1</version> </plugin> <plugin> <artifactId>maven-war-plugin</artifactId> <version>3.2.0</version> </plugin> <plugin> <artifactId>maven-install-plugin</artifactId> <version>2.5.2</version> </plugin> <plugin> <artifactId>maven-deploy-plugin</artifactId> <version>2.8.2</version> </plugin> </plugins> </pluginManagement> </build></project>
然后等待idea自动下载一堆jar的包,如果没有自动下载的可以点这里:
所有的包下载完成后控制台会有提示的。
*4.配置spring、spring和MyBatis的整合配置文件,最重要的一步也是最麻烦的一步同样也是最难的一步。不过不要怕,我们一步一步慢慢来。
这里内容有点多,就不多说啥了,直接粘代码,需要的复制过去就OK了。
spring-mybatis.xml文件源码:
<?xml version="1.0" encoding="UTF-8"?><beans xmlns="http://www.springframework.org/schema/beans"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xmlns:context="http://www.springframework.org/schema/context" xmlns:tx="http://www.springframework.org/schema/tx" xsi:schemaLocation="http://www.springframework.org/schema/beans http://www.springframework.org/schema/beans/spring-beans.xsd http://www.springframework.org/schema/context http://www.springframework.org/schema/context/spring-context.xsd http://www.springframework.org/schema/tx http://www.springframework.org/schema/tx/spring-tx.xsd"> <context:property-placeholder location="classpath:config/jdbc.properties"/> <bean id="dataSource" class="org.apache.commons.dbcp.BasicDataSource"> <property name="driverClassName" value="${jdbc.driver}"/> <property name="url" value="${jdbc.url}"/> <property name="username" value="${jdbc.user}"/> <property name="password" value="${jdbc.password}"/> </bean> <bean id="SqlSessionFactory" class="org.mybatis.spring.SqlSessionFactoryBean"> <property name="dataSource" ref="dataSource"/> <property name="typeAliasesPackage" value="com.**.model"/> <property name="mapperLocations" value="classpath*:mapper/UserMapper.xml"/> </bean> <bean class="org.mybatis.spring.mapper.MapperScannerConfigurer"> <property name="basePackage" value="com.**.mapper"/> <property name="sqlSessionFactoryBeanName" > <idref bean="SqlSessionFactory"/> </property> </bean> <context:component-scan base-package="com.**.service"/> <bean id="transactionManager" class="org.springframework.jdbc.datasource.DataSourceTransactionManager"> <property name="dataSource" ref="dataSource"/> </bean> <tx:annotation-driven transaction-manager="transactionManager"/></beans>
spring-mvc.xml源码:
<?xml version="1.0" encoding="UTF-8"?><beans xmlns="http://www.springframework.org/schema/beans"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xmlns:context="http://www.springframework.org/schema/context" xmlns:mvc="http://www.springframework.org/schema/mvc" xsi:schemaLocation="http://www.springframework.org/schema/beans http://www.springframework.org/schema/beans/spring-beans.xsd http://www.springframework.org/schema/context http://www.springframework.org/schema/context/spring-context.xsd http://www.springframework.org/schema/mvc http://www.springframework.org/schema/mvc/spring-mvc.xsd"> <context:annotation-config/> <mvc:annotation-driven> <mvc:message-converters register-defaults="true"> <bean class="com.alibaba.fastjson.support.spring.FastJsonHttpMessageConverter"> <property name="supportedMediaTypes"> <list> <value>application/json;charset=UTF-8</value> </list> </property> <property name="features"> <list> <value>WriteDateUseDateFormat</value> <value>QuoteFieldNames</value> </list> </property> </bean> <bean class="org.springframework.http.converter.StringHttpMessageConverter"> <property name="supportedMediaTypes"> <list><value>text/html;charset=UTF-8</value></list> </property> </bean> </mvc:message-converters> </mvc:annotation-driven> <context:component-scan base-package="com.ssm.controller"> <context:include-filter type="annotation" expression="org.springframework.stereotype.Controller"/> </context:component-scan> <bean id="viewResolver" class="org.springframework.web.servlet.view.InternalResourceViewResolver"> <property name="prefix" value="/WEB-INF/jsp/"/> <property name="suffix" value=".jsp"/> </bean> <mvc:resources mapping="/lib/**" location="/lib"/> <bean id="multipartResolver" class="org.springframework.web.multipart.commons.CommonsMultipartResolver"> <property name="defaultEncoding" value="utf-8"/> <property name="maxUploadSize" value="10485760000"/> <property name="maxInMemorySize" value="40960"/> </bean> </beans>
web.xml文件也是需要配置的,源码如下:
<?xml version="1.0" encoding="UTF-8"?><web-app xmlns="http://java.sun.com/xml/ns/javaee"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://java.sun.com/xml/ns/javaee http://java.sun.com/xml/ns/javaee/web-app_3_0.xsd" version="3.0"> <display-name>Archetype Created Web Application</display-name> <context-param> <param-name>contextConfigLocation</param-name> <param-value>classpath:/config/spring-mybatis.xml</param-value> </context-param> <context-param> <param-name>log4jConfigLocation</param-name> <param-value>classpath:config/log4j.properties</param-value> </context-param> <context-param> <param-name>log4jRefreshInterval</param-name> <param-value>60000</param-value> </context-param> <filter> <filter-name>SpringEncodingFilter</filter-name> <filter-class>org.springframework.web.filter.CharacterEncodingFilter</filter-class> <init-param> <param-name>encoding</param-name> <param-value>UTF-8</param-value> </init-param> <init-param> <param-name>forceEncoding</param-name> <param-value>true</param-value> </init-param> </filter> <filter-mapping> <filter-name>SpringEncodingFilter</filter-name> <url-pattern>/*</url-pattern> </filter-mapping> <listener> <listener-class>org.springframework.web.context.ContextLoaderListener</listener-class> </listener> <listener> <listener-class>org.springframework.web.util.IntrospectorCleanupListener</listener-class> </listener> <servlet> <servlet-name>spring</servlet-name> <servlet-class>org.springframework.web.servlet.DispatcherServlet</servlet-class> <init-param> <param-name>contextConfigLocation</param-name> <param-value>classpath:config/spring-mvc.xml </param-value> </init-param> <load-on-startup>1</load-on-startup> </servlet> <servlet-mapping> <servlet-name>spring</servlet-name> <url-pattern>/</url-pattern> </servlet-mapping> </web-app>
log4j相信大家都不陌生,在项目中我们常常会用到日志,因此非常有必要配置一下日志信息。
log4j.properties源码如下:
log4j.rootLogger = DEBUG,Console,File log4j.appender.Console = org.apache.log4j.ConsoleAppender#log4j.appender.Console.Target = System.out log4j.appender.Console.layout = org.apache.log4j.PatternLayoutlog4j.appender.Console.layout.ConversionPattern = %5p %d %C: %m%n #每天打印一个日志文件log4j.appender.File = org.apache.log4j.DailyRollingFileAppenderlog4j.appender.File.File=E:/logs/SSMDemo.loglog4j.appender.File.Encoding=UTF-8#打印所有级别的日志信息log4j.appender.File.Threshold = ALLlog4j.appender.File.layout = org.apache.log4j.PatternLayoutlog4j.appender.File.layout.ConversionPattern =%d{ABSOLUTE} %5p %c{1}\:%L - %m%n log4j.logger.com.opensymphony=ERRORlog4j.logger.org.springframework=ERROR log4j.logger.org.apache=INFOlog4j.logger.java.sql.Connection=INFOlog4j.logger.java.sql.PreparedStatement=INFOlog4j.logger.java.sql.ResultSet=INFOlog4j.logger.java.sql.Statement=INFO
jdbc也是必不可少的一部分,毕竟数据都是来源于数据库的嘛。
jdbc.properties源码如下:
#开发环境jdbc.driver=com.mysql.jdbc.Driverjdbc.url=jdbc:mysql://localhost:3306/mydatabase_testjdbc.user=your usernamejdbc.password=your password
到这里我们的配置文件就算说完了(当然这是最基础的需要,SSM的功能十分强大,还可以嵌入很多很多的功能...)
5.依葫芦画瓢,编写各层的功能类即可,controller层主要写http请求的接口方法,service主要写各种业务操作算法等,mapper层也可以称为dao层(我的习惯是写成mapper层)主要是写映射到数据库的方法接口,**Mapper.xml文件主要是写mapper层中的接口功能的SQL语句实现。这样的分层管理应该可以兼容各种大大小小的项目了。
下面也贴上我的工程中各层的测试代码。
model实体类:
package com.ssm.model; public class User { private int id; private String name; private int age; private String sex; public User() {} public int getId() { return id;} public void setId(int id) { this.id = id;} public String getName() { return name;} public void setName(String name) { this.name = name;} public int getAge() { return age;} public void setAge(int age) { this.age = age;} public String getSex() { return sex;} public void setSex(String sex) { this.sex = sex;} @Override public String toString() { return "User{" + "id=" + id + ", name='" + name + '\'' + ", age=" + age + ", sex='" + sex + '\'' + '}';}}
controller层:
package com.ssm.controller; import com.ssm.model.User;import com.ssm.service.UserService;import org.apache.log4j.Logger;import org.springframework.beans.factory.annotation.Autowired;import org.springframework.web.bind.annotation.RequestMapping;import org.springframework.web.bind.annotation.ResponseBody;import org.springframework.web.bind.annotation.RestController; import java.util.List; @RestController@RequestMapping("user")public class UserController { @Autowired private UserService userService;Logger log = Logger.getLogger(UserController.class); @RequestMapping("select") @ResponseBody public Object userTest(int id){System.out.println("测试成功~~"+id);List<User> user = userService.getUser(id);System.out.println(user.toString());log.info(user); return user;} @RequestMapping("addUser") public Object insertUser(int id,String name,int age,String sex){userService.insertUser(id,name,age,sex); return "OK";} @RequestMapping("selectAll") public Object selectAll(){ return userService.selectAll();} @RequestMapping("update") public Object update(){ return userService.update();} }
service层(service层一般都是比较复杂的,因此我习惯分成接口和实现类两部分)接口:
package com.ssm.service; import com.ssm.model.User; import java.util.List;public interface UserService { List<User> getUser(int id); void insertUser(int id, String name, int age, String sex); List<User> selectAll(); Object update();}
service层实现类:
package com.ssm.service.impl; import com.ssm.mapper.UserMapper;import com.ssm.model.User;import com.ssm.service.UserService;import org.springframework.beans.factory.annotation.Autowired;import org.springframework.stereotype.Service; import java.util.HashMap;import java.util.List;import java.util.Map; @Servicepublic class UserServiceImpl implements UserService { @Autowired private UserMapper userMapper; public List<User> getUser(int id) {Map map = new HashMap();map.put("id",id); return userMapper.getUser(map);} public void insertUser(int id, String name, int age, String sex) {Map param = new HashMap();param.put("id",id);param.put("name",name);param.put("age",age);param.put("sex",sex);userMapper.insertUser(param);} public List<User> selectAll() { return userMapper.selectAll();} public Object update() {Map param = new HashMap();param.put("total",10);param.put("name","测试一");userMapper.update(param); return "OK";}}
mapper层(dao层)接口:
package com.ssm.mapper; import com.ssm.model.User;import org.apache.ibatis.annotations.Param; import java.util.List;import java.util.Map;public interface UserMapper { List<User> getUser(@Param("param") Map map); void insertUser(@Param("param") Map param); List<User> selectAll(); void update(@Param("param") Map param);}
**Mapper.xml MaBatsis映射文件配置文件,相当于mapper层接口的实现类了:
<?xml version="1.0" encoding="UTF-8" ?><!DOCTYPE mapper P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N" "http://mybatis.org/dtd/mybatis-3-mapper.dtd"><mapper namespace="com.ssm.mapper.UserMapper"> <select id="getUser" parameterType="java.util.Map" resultType="com.ssm.model.User">SELECT *FROM userwhere id =#{param.id} </select> <insert id="insertUser" parameterType="java.util.Map">INSERT INTO user (id,name,age,sex) values(#{param.id},#{param.name},#{param.age},#{param.sex}) </insert> <select id="selectAll" resultType="com.ssm.model.User">SELECT * FROM USER </select> <update id="update" parameterType="java.util.Map">UPDATE USER SET id=id-#{param.total},age=age+#{param.total}WHERE name=#{param.name} </update></mapper>
为了方便大家拷下代码后可以直接启动,我把数据库的sql语句和数据也贴上,我用的是mysql数据库:
SET FOREIGN_KEY_CHECKS=0; DROP TABLE IF EXISTS `user`;CREATE TABLE `user` ( `id` int(11) NOT NULL, `name` varchar(20) DEFAULT NULL, `age` int(11) DEFAULT NULL, `sex` varchar(10) DEFAULT NULL,PRIMARY KEY (`id`)) ENGINE=InnoDB DEFAULT CHARSET=utf8; INSERT INTO `user` VALUES ('2', '测试二', '22', '男');INSERT INTO `user` VALUES ('3', '小二郎', '18', '男');INSERT INTO `user` VALUES ('4', '二郎', '18', '男');INSERT INTO `user` VALUES ('5', '马英', '26', '女');INSERT INTO `user` VALUES ('6', '王尼玛', '30', '男');INSERT INTO `user` VALUES ('7', '张三疯', '109', '男');INSERT INTO `user` VALUES ('8', '欧阳翻天', '76', '女');INSERT INTO `user` VALUES ('9', '上官', '16', '女');INSERT INTO `user` VALUES ('10', '李响', '30', '男');INSERT INTO `user` VALUES ('11', '测试一', '0', '女');
